Internal Memo — Revised Sales-Commission Scheme

To the incoming director: the commission structure changes next quarter. Base rate drops from 6% to 4%, offset by an accelerator of 10% on sales above individual targets. Renewals on the Ferndale product line now count at half weight. Modelling by the planning team suggests top performers gain, mid-tier stays flat. Expect pushback from the Westholm branch, where renewals dominate. A townhall is scheduled for week two of the quarter. For context, the rationale below is confidential.

management briefing: The pricing group signed off on a budget of $378.8 million for Project Kasael.

**Checklist — Off-site run: recalled chargers**

- [ ] Shrink-wrap the pallet of recalled VoltNook chargers in Bay 2 — don't mix them with outbound stock.
- [ ] Attach the red recall tags and log the pallet count for the records file.
- [ ] Get a signature from the Dunmere facility on arrival.

The courier hand-over instruction for this pallet appears below.

handover note for yagef-bagep: the drudor pelius courier leaves the kasdor zorvan norir ledger at gate 8016 under passcode 755406

**Q: Will the ORM refactor in Lanternworks 4.x break my plugin?** Possibly. The legacy Graftwell ORM layer is being replaced module by module; query builder hooks are deprecated but shimmed through the 4.x series. Plugins touching raw session objects must migrate by 5.0. A compatibility matrix and migration examples are maintained on this page.

wiki page, tahaf-tajog: https://jira.ordindyn.corp/pipeline

Splits the user module out of the Hollowmere monolith into `userd`. Auth, profile, and session code moved; billing stays put for now. No behavior changes intended — wire formats are identical. Run the contract tests before touching anything in `session/`. The new service reads its limits from `userd.conf` at boot; the defaults checked in with this PR are the following.

constants for fajop-tahaf:
RATE_LIMITS = {
    "holael": 2,
    "oliael": 10,
    "druael": 10,
    "wenwyn": 10,
}